Customer Challenges: Limited Value from Raw Calcium Carbonate

Located in Minya City, Egypt, the customer owned a large deposit of natural calcium carbonate. However, selling unprocessed or coarsely ground material on the market brought only low returns and limited market demand. Without the capability to produce high-grade fine powder, the customer was unable to tap into higher-value downstream industries such as plastics, rubber, coatings, and construction — all of which require finely ground or surface-treated calcium carbonate as functional fillers.

Customer Needs: Upgrade Material, Increase Value
To break out of the commodity trap and increase the profit margin, the customer was seeking a reliable, efficient, and cost-effective grinding solution. The goal was to produce ultra-fine calcium carbonate powder (D97 5–45µm), with part of it coated for applications requiring improved dispersion and surface performance.

Key requirements included:

Stable production of 8–10 micron D97 powder

Surface modification system for added product value

Energy-efficient operation

Easy maintenance and long-term reliability

Daswell Solution: Tailored Grinding + Coating System

After careful evaluation of the customer’s material, product goals, and factory layout, Daswell engineers proposed a Grinding Mill and Vortex Mill Coating Machine, capable of producing consistent fine powder with optional surface treatment. The system was designed for high output, minimal downtime, and optimal energy efficiency.

Final Production Line Delivered

The final production line included:

Φ2.2×5.5m Ball Mill – for efficient fine grinding

AMS10003 Air Classifier – for precise particle size control

XMC70-7 Bag Dust Collector – for clean and safe operation

Vortex Mill Coating Machine – for added functionality and product performance

This configuration enables the production of:

D97 10µm powder at 2.8–3.1 tons/hour

D97 8µm powder at 2.2–2.4 tons/hour

Daswell calcium carbonate production line Installed Successfully in Tanzania https://daswell.com/powder-cases/daswell-calcium-carbonate-production-line-installed-successfully-in-tanzania/ Wed, 23 Jul 2025 08:34:00 +0000 https://daswell.com/?p=6783 In May 2025, Daswell sent our engineers to Tanzania for installing the calcium carbonate production line. The client is a leading industrial mineral processor in Tanzania. They want to establish a high-capacity calcium carbonate production line to meet the growing demand for fine-grade fillers in masterbatch and other industrial applications. They found Daswell Machinery as their supplier after long-term research.

Key requirements of our Tanzanian customer

Precision particle size control: The client needs production of D97 10 micron and 8 micron calcium carbonate powder.

Wide application range: They want to have a production line, which has ability to produce 5-45 micron D97 powder for versatile use in plastic, paints, and coatings.

Required solution: Want to have a fully integrated system from crushing to surface coating. And the production line should make sure consistency and minimal downtime.

Daswell solution and production line Recommendations for Tanzanian Customer

Daswell recommends a calcium carbonate milling and coating plant for our Tanzanian client. This deployed system combines crushing, grinding, classification, and coating technologies to deliver exceptional performance:

Crushing plant: This system can pre-process raw calcium carbonate into optimal feed size for efficient grinding.

Ball mill grinding(2.2*5.5m): The ball mill grinding machine ensures high-capacity fine grinding with low energy consumption.

ASM10003 classifier: It achieves precise particle size distribution(D97 8-45 microns) with high yield and minimal oversize.

XMC70-7 bag dust filter: The dust filter enhances environmental compliance by capturing 99.9% of dust emissions.

UCOAT750 coating plant: This vortex mill coating machine provides uniform surface modification for improving the compatibility in masterbatch applications.

Production capacity: Produce D97, 10 Micron about 2.8-3.1ton/hour and 8 micron with 2.2-2.4ton/hour.

Daswell Second Ball Mill Grinding Plant with Classifier for Silica and Feldspar Powder in Egypt https://daswell.com/powder-cases/daswell-second-ball-mill-grinding-plant-with-classifier-for-silica-and-feldspar-powder-in-egypt/ Thu, 13 Mar 2025 07:02:00 +0000 https://daswell.com/?p=7137 In July 2014, Daswell sent the second silica and feldspar processing plant for our Egypt customer. They have bought a set of ball mill grinding plant with a classifier in 2013. The plant performed exceptionally well. It operated nearly 21/7 with minimal maintenance. Our customer praised machine’s stability, efficiency, and durability. Thus, they contacted us in May 2014. And they purchased the second quartz sand processing plant with higher-capacity system.

What machines did our Egypt customer purchase for the second silica and feldspar powder making plant?

It mainly includes:

Ball mill machine: 2.4x8m ball mill grinding machine

Classifier: ASS830 single wheel classifier, which is 400mm diameter

Dust Collector: SMC70-6 bag dust collector

Production Capacity: It can produce 38 micron about 3.2 tons per hour, 45 micron 3.8 tons per hour, 100 micron 5.8 tons per hour.

This system ensures high-precision classifications and consistent output quality, making it ideal for ceramic and industrial applications.

Success Cases: How DASWELL Transformed Silica Powder Production in Egypt https://daswell.com/powder-cases/success-cases-daswell-silica-powder-production-line-in-egypt/ Fri, 09 Aug 2024 09:36:00 +0000 https://daswell.com/?p=6942 At the end of 2012, a silica and feldspar powder producer in Sadat City, Egypt, sent an inquiry to Daswell. They have purchased a ball mill plant from another Chinese supplier. But those machines had some problems.

Poor classifier design: The classifier wheel has been worn because of inadequate protection against abrasive silica powder.

Low productivity: The system layout was inefficient. The classifier and dust collector were misaligned, wasting energy and reducing capacity.

Frequent downtime: The processing machines had poor quality, so they should repair the machine constantly.

Daswell Solutions: Engineered for Durability and Efficiency

After evaluating Daswell’s proven track record in recent years, our customer decided to partner with us for upgrading their production line. Our technical experts designed a new plant for their manufacturing. The main equipment included:

Ball Mill Grinding Machine: 2.2*7.5m Ball mill plant

Classifier: ASS630 classifier

Dust Collector: XMC60-4 dust collector

What are the advantages of Daswell ball mill grinding plant?

  • High-efficiency Grinding Mill: The ball mill machine can produce D98, 5 to 200 microns. The ball mill equipment we provided can meet customers’ requirements, producing D98, 150micron, 100 micron, and 45 micron silica and feldspar powder.
  • Advanced classifier technology: The ASS630 single-wheel classifier utilizes alumina ceramic and polyurethane blade protection, which resists silica abrasion.

  • Robust system integration: We have optimized the layout. The classifier and dust collector are aligned to minimize power waste. And we adopted premium components for ensuring the machine’s quality and efficiency. We choose Siemens motors and NSK/SKF bearings for reliability. The dust collector employed the ASCO valves and BWF bags for maximizing dust collection efficiency. Meanwhile, all the control cabinets were equipped with Schneider electric parts, realizing automated operation.
  • Wear-resistant material science: The discharging screens used special alloy for withstanding silica abrasion. And the contact parts have been reinforced, extending the service life.

Daswell delivered and installed the whole grinding line in Egypt in August 2013. Using Daswell ball mill grinding plant with classifier for silica and feldspar powder, the production capacity is 200% higher. They can produce 150 micron powders 6.5 tons per hour. Moreover, the high-quality classifier reduces 70% the maintenance costs. And the streamlined design also reduces power waste, saving more energy.
